EPO Finances Committee
Size:
The committee shall have a maximum of four full members, and up to four substitute members
Task of the Committee:
The Committee is concerned with the financial affairs of the EPO.
The Committee’s work is mostly driven by preparing for meetings of the Budget and Finance Committee of the EPO, which ordinarily has two meetings a year, normally in May and October. epi delegates attend these meetings as observers.
Most documents requiring assessment come out during the month preceding each meeting.
Occasionally the Committee is asked at short notice to advise on matters outside this bi-annual cycle.
The Committee thus has prolonged periods of inactivity with short periods of intense workload. Nearly all meetings are by video conference.
